Windows 10 wireless connectivity
Posted on 4/7/16 at 7:52 am
Posted on 4/7/16 at 7:52 am
I have recently upgraded my Asus laptop at home to Windows 10. Since then, my wireless connectivity keeps dropping. I recently updated the drivers for the wireless card, but it still is a problem (it will connect, but will lose connectivity after a few minutes). Does anyone have any suggestions?
Posted on 4/7/16 at 8:26 am to madmaxvol
power management option for the wireless adapter?
Did you try drivers from manufacturer website? Did you try disabling/uninstalling wireless driver and see if it re-installed after a reboot?
